Course Requirements

This module/micro course helps learners understand the concepts of gender equality and gender stereotypes. It encourages the use of innovative methods to apply egalitarian pedagogy, exploit technology, and develop entrepreneurship for women's empowerment.

Course Description

This micro course provides a starting point for learning about gender equality and women's empowerment, including gender stereotypes that women face in education, employment, and the labour market. How can these biases be reduced using innovative methods for egalitarian pedagogy and women's empowerment? It promotes participation in decision-making and economic women empowerment through gender egalitarian pedagogy.

The mini course will highlight the female role models in different disciplines globally and in Egypt. They are sources of inspiration for the women of tomorrow.

Course Outcomes

After completing the course, the learner should be able to:

  1. Understand the concepts of gender equality and inequality.
  2. Understand the basic rights of women and girls, including their right to leadership and decision-making.
  3. Know the opportunities and benefits provided by full gender equality and participation in governance.
  4. Understand the role of education in achieving gender equality, enabling women through technology, and ensuring the full participation of all genders.
  5. Identify forms of gender discrimination in education and the labour market and defend the empowerment of all genders.
  6. Suggest educational scenarios that can be applied to ensure gender equality.
  7. Use interactive pedagogies such as interactions with society and encouragement of women's leadership in the educational process.
  8. Observe and identify gender stereotypes.
  9. Analyze gender stereotypes in the curriculum.
  10. Conduct student projects, case studies, and undergraduate research to achieve gender equality, women’s empowerment, and decision-making in various disciplines.
  11. Plan, implement, and evaluate E-Teaching scenarios for gender equality.
